Abstract
General Packet Radio Service (GPRS) is a new service which provides packet radio access for users based on the Global System in Mobile Communications (GSM) technology. It is an important step towards packet switching paradigms in mobile communications. The integration of GPRS into GSM has created conditions to extend mobile communications over public packet networks, such as the Internet or corporate intranets where leased lines or virtual private networks (VPNs) are used to interconnect GPRS support nodes. A tendency now is to use the optical technology to transport data over public networks. In this case, dedicated optical channels or optical VPNs (OVPNs) are used to support GPRS over optical networks. This paper considers the extension of GPRS over optical networks. As the impact of GPRS roaming, a based-agent model is also proposed for dynamic management and configuration of OVPNs.
